Why These Are the Top Windows Contractors in Castle Hayne

** The window service market in the Castle Hayne and greater Wilmington area is robust and competitive, driven by the region's specific climate needs. The proximity to the coast creates a high demand for impact-resistant or storm windows, as well as windows that can withstand humidity and salt air while maintaining energy efficiency. Homeowners have a clear choice between premium, full-service providers like Renewal by Andersen and Pella, which offer superior materials and customization at a higher price point, and value-oriented, high-volume companies like Window World, which provide reliable and affordable solutions. Typical pricing reflects this split, with standard vinyl double-hung window replacements starting in the **$400-$700 per window** range for value providers, while premium wood or composite windows with advanced features can range from **$1,000 to $1,800+ per window**. The market is served by a mix of nationally recognized brands with local branches and established regional contractors, all of which are accustomed to navigating local building codes and the unique environmental challenges of coastal North Carolina.

Frequently Asked Questions About Windows in Castle Hayne

Get answers to common questions about windows services in Castle Hayne, North Carolina.

1What is the typical cost range for a full home window replacement in Castle Hayne, and what factors influence the price?

In the Castle Hayne and greater Wilmington area, a full home window replacement typically ranges from $8,000 to $20,000+, depending on the home's size and window count. Key cost factors include the window material (vinyl, fiberglass, or wood), the quality of the glass package (crucial for our coastal humidity and storm potential), and the complexity of the installation, especially in older homes common to the area. Labor costs are also influenced by local demand, which can be seasonal.

2How does the coastal North Carolina climate impact my choice of windows for a Castle Hayne home?

Castle Hayne's humid subtropical climate and proximity to the coast make specific window features essential. You should prioritize windows with Low-E glass and argon gas fills to combat heat gain and UV damage, and look for excellent weatherstripping to manage humidity and prevent air infiltration. For storm resilience, which is a key local consideration, look for windows certified to meet Miami-Dade County HVHZ standards or those with a Design Pressure (DP) rating suitable for our high-wind zone.

3Are there specific permits or regulations required for window installation in Castle Hayne, NC?

Yes, New Hanover County, which includes Castle Hayne, generally requires a building permit for window replacement if you are altering the structural opening. Furthermore, installations must comply with the North Carolina Residential Building Code, which includes specific energy efficiency and wind-load requirements for our coastal region. A reputable local installer will handle this permitting process for you, ensuring compliance with all county regulations.

4What is the best time of year to schedule a window installation in Castle Hayne, and how long does the project usually take?

The ideal times are during the milder spring and fall seasons to avoid the peak summer heat and the more unpredictable weather of late summer hurricane season. For a standard full-home replacement, the project typically takes 1-3 days for a professional crew. However, scheduling can be competitive during these optimal periods, so planning several weeks or months in advance with a local contractor is advisable.

5What should I look for when choosing a window installation company serving Castle Hayne?

Prioritize companies with extensive local experience, as they understand the specific climate and building code challenges of our area. Verify they are properly licensed and insured in North Carolina, and ask for references from recent projects in New Hanover County. A trustworthy provider will offer a detailed, in-home estimate (not just a phone quote), provide clear information on product warranties, and have a proven process for managing the county permit requirements.
